Group and Round Robin Meetings links should appear in Meetings for all users who are a part of them

Currently, for any team Meetings links (Group or Round Robin) the link only appears in the list of meetings for the user who created the link. This means other users cannot see the link in their list of links, or edit it.

Yes, I have the same issue with quite a few clients for which we set up HubSpot for Service and Sales. It would be great to have the following improvements for the meetings tool that are closely related to this idea:

 

  • admins should be able to see (and ideally even modify and clone) all meeting links of all users (personal and team / round-robin). This would allow e.g. a head of sales to set up links for a whole team and ensure quality and e.g. similar wording for meetings of individual sales reps.
  • team / round-robin meetings should be visible for everyone. maybe even personal meeting links of other team members
  • team / round-robin meeting links are now tied to someone's personal meeting URL.  as it's a team meeting link, this doesn't make sense and looks strange to customers. this should not be the case and the URL should be definable by admins (of course within the limits that they must be unique)
  • I should have the option to change meeting URLs after creation, or (as I understand that there are negative implications with that) I should at least be able to clone / copy a meeting to create a similar meeting link with a new URL that I can change when cloning

All those improvements would imho make the meetings tool a lot more usable and manageable by companies with multiple sales or customer service employees!

Hi all,

 

Users can now see all links connected to their calendar, regardless of who owns them. Super Admins also have the permission to edit those links. Let me know if we missed anything on this idea: lars (at) hubspot.com

I'm a super admin on our account. One issue I'm running into is when I go to edit a group link with two users (let's say Amy the owner and Jill the additional person), the user who is not the owner (Jill) gets removed automatically and I see the error "A user was removed from this link We’ve removed a user on this link who is no longer a user in this account. Please confirm the group members on this link and then save it."

 

The problem though is the user who was removed is still an active user and should not be removed, and I cannot add them back as their name no longer appears in the drop down list. I have to cancel and cannot edit the link becuase if I do it saves with Jill missing. Does it have something to do with the Team the user is on? On our group links the additonal people are all members of a different Team than the owners of the links.
